What is AI Document Analysis?

AI document analysis leverages a sophisticated combination of artificial intelligence technologies to automate and enhance document processing workflows. At its core, it employs machine learning algorithms and natural language processing (NLP) to understand, extract, and analyze information from documents with minimal human intervention[2].

Unlike traditional document processing methods that rely heavily on manual data entry and predefined templates, AI document analysis can:

  • Process unstructured and semi-structured documents
  • Identify and extract key information without rigid templates
  • Understand context and relationships between data points
  • Learn and improve over time through continuous feedback
  • Handle documents in multiple languages and formats

This intelligent approach represents a paradigm shift from conventional document processing, enabling businesses to process more documents with greater accuracy and extract deeper insights in less time.

The Technology Behind AI Document Analysis

Modern AI document analysis platforms combine several advanced technologies to deliver comprehensive document processing capabilities:

Optical Character Recognition (OCR)

OCR technology forms the foundation of document analysis by converting physical or digital documents into machine-readable text. Modern AI-enhanced OCR can accurately recognize text even in challenging scenarios like handwritten notes, low-quality scans, or unusual fonts[3].

Natural Language Processing (NLP)

NLP enables systems to understand the semantic meaning of text beyond mere character recognition. Through NLP, document analysis platforms can identify entities, categorize content, determine sentiment, and understand the relationships between different textual elements[4].

Computer Vision

Computer vision algorithms help AI systems understand the visual layout of documents, recognize tables, images, charts, and other non-textual elements. This technology is crucial for maintaining the structural integrity of information during extraction[5].

Machine Learning

Machine learning models allow document analysis systems to improve over time by learning from user corrections and feedback. These systems become increasingly accurate as they process more documents, adapting to organization-specific document types and extraction requirements.

Deep Learning

Deep learning, particularly transformer-based models like those powering advanced language models, enables AI document analysis to understand complex document contexts and nuances that would be impossible with rule-based approaches.

Key Benefits of AI Document Analysis

Organizations implementing AI document analysis solutions are realizing substantial benefits across multiple dimensions:

Operational Efficiency

By automating document processing tasks that previously required manual intervention, businesses can reallocate human resources to higher-value activities. A study by Deloitte found that organizations implementing intelligent document processing solutions experienced productivity improvements of 50-70% in document-heavy workflows[7].

Enhanced Accuracy

AI document analysis significantly reduces the error rates associated with manual data entry and processing. Modern systems can achieve accuracy rates exceeding 95% for many document types, far surpassing typical manual processing accuracy[8].

Cost Reduction

While implementing AI document analysis requires initial investment, the long-term cost savings are substantial. Organizations typically report 40-60% cost reductions in document processing operations after full implementation[9].

Improved Compliance

AI document analysis platforms can automatically flag potential compliance issues, maintain comprehensive audit trails, and ensure consistent processing according to regulatory requirements. This proactive approach minimizes compliance risks and associated penalties.

Accelerated Decision-Making

By extracting and analyzing document data more quickly, businesses gain faster access to critical information, enabling more timely and informed decision-making processes.

Scalability

Unlike manual document processing that requires proportional workforce increases to handle volume growth, AI document analysis solutions can scale effortlessly to accommodate fluctuating document volumes without corresponding resource expansion.

Enhanced Customer Experience

Faster document processing translates directly to improved customer experiences, whether in loan approvals, insurance claims processing, or contract management. Research indicates that organizations leveraging AI for document processing reduce customer wait times by an average of 65%[10].

Industry Applications of AI Document Analysis

The versatility of AI document analysis makes it valuable across virtually every industry that deals with significant document volumes. Here are some of the most impactful applications:

Financial Services

Banks and financial institutions are leveraging AI document analysis to transform operations in multiple areas:

  • Loan Processing: Automating the extraction of information from loan applications and supporting documents, reducing processing time by up to 70%[11].
  • KYC/AML Compliance: Extracting and verifying customer information from identity documents, improving compliance while reducing manual review time.
  • Invoice Processing: Automatically extracting line items, totals, and payment terms from invoices of varying formats.
  • Financial Statement Analysis: Extracting and analyzing data from financial statements to identify trends and anomalies.

Healthcare

The healthcare industry faces unique challenges with document management that AI analysis is helping to address:

  • Medical Records Processing: Extracting relevant patient information from diverse medical documents and consolidating it into structured formats for easier access and analysis.
  • Claims Processing: Automating the extraction of diagnosis codes, treatment information, and billing details from medical claims.
  • Clinical Trial Documentation: Managing and analyzing the extensive documentation required for clinical trials, ensuring regulatory compliance.
  • Patient Intake: Streamlining the processing of new patient forms and documentation, reducing administrative burden and improving patient experience.

Legal

Law firms and legal departments are finding tremendous value in AI document analysis:

  • Contract Analysis: Automatically identifying key clauses, obligations, risks, and opportunities across large contract portfolios.
  • Due Diligence: Accelerating M&A due diligence by quickly analyzing thousands of documents to identify potential issues.
  • Legal Research: Extracting relevant case information and precedents from legal documents to support case preparation.
  • eDiscovery: Efficiently processing large document collections to identify relevant information for litigation.

Insurance

Insurance companies are streamlining document-heavy processes through AI analysis:

  • Claims Processing: Extracting information from claim forms, police reports, medical records, and other supporting documentation.
  • Policy Administration: Managing and analyzing policy documents to ensure consistent terms and coverage.
  • Underwriting: Analyzing applicant documentation to support risk assessment and pricing decisions.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ensuring policy documents adhere to evolving regulatory requirements across jurisdictions.

Government and Public Sector

Government agencies are improving citizen services through more efficient document processing:

  • Permit and License Processing: Automating the extraction of information from application forms and supporting documents.
  • Tax Document Processing: Extracting and validating information from tax returns and supporting documentation.
  • Benefits Administration: Processing applications and supporting documents for government benefit programs.
  • Records Management: Digitizing and extracting information from historical records and archives.

Implementing AI Document Analysis: Best Practices

Successfully implementing AI document analysis requires a strategic approach. Here are key best practices based on industry experience:

1. Start with a Clear Business Case

Identify specific document-intensive processes that would benefit most from automation. Quantify current costs, processing times, and error rates to establish a baseline for measuring improvement.

2. Begin with Pilot Projects

Start with a limited scope to demonstrate value and build organizational confidence. Choose document types with high volume and standardized formats for initial implementation.

3. Invest in Training

Allocate resources to properly train AI models on your specific document types. The quality of training directly impacts accuracy and effectiveness.

4. Plan for Integration

Ensure the AI document analysis solution integrates seamlessly with existing systems and workflows. API connectivity and flexible output formats are essential.

5. Maintain Human Oversight

Implement validation processes where AI confidence scores fall below certain thresholds. Human review of complex or unusual documents improves system learning.

6. Monitor Performance

Establish key performance indicators (KPIs) to track accuracy, processing time, cost savings, and other relevant metrics. Regular performance reviews help identify improvement opportunities.

7. Continuously Improve

Use feedback loops to continually refine and enhance the AI models. Document any exceptions or challenges to inform system improvements.

8. Address Change Management

Proactively manage the organizational change aspects of implementation. Clear communication about roles, responsibilities, and benefits helps ensure user adoption.

Overcoming Implementation Challenges

While the benefits of AI document analysis are compelling, organizations should be prepared to address common challenges:

Data Quality and Variability

Document quality issues like poor scans, handwritten annotations, or non-standard formats can impact processing accuracy. Implementing pre-processing steps and training models on diverse document examples can help address these challenges.

Integration Complexity

Connecting AI document analysis solutions with legacy systems can be complex. Working with vendors offering robust APIs and integration support is essential for seamless implementation.

Compliance Considerations

Ensuring AI document processing meets regulatory requirements for data privacy and security is critical. Organizations should implement appropriate controls and audit capabilities to maintain compliance[12].

User Adoption

Resistance to change can impede successful implementation. Comprehensive training, clear communication of benefits, and involvement of end-users in the implementation process can overcome adoption challenges.

Measuring ROI

Quantifying the full benefits of AI document analysis can be challenging. Establishing comprehensive metrics that capture both direct cost savings and indirect benefits like improved decision-making and customer satisfaction is important.

The Future of AI Document Analysis

The field of AI document analysis continues to evolve rapidly, with several emerging trends shaping its future:

Multimodal AI

Future document analysis systems will seamlessly integrate text, image, and audio analysis capabilities, enabling more comprehensive understanding of complex documents that combine multiple information types.

Enhanced Contextual Understanding

Advances in large language models are dramatically improving AI's ability to understand document context, enabling more sophisticated analysis of complex documents like contracts and legal agreements.

Zero-Shot Learning

Emerging AI models can accurately process document types they've never seen before, reducing the need for extensive training on specific document formats.

Explainable AI

As regulatory scrutiny increases, document analysis solutions are incorporating greater transparency in how they reach conclusions, making it easier to validate results and ensure compliance.

Edge Processing

Document analysis capabilities are increasingly being deployed at the edge, enabling real-time processing even in environments with limited connectivity.

Cross-Document Intelligence

Future systems will more effectively analyze relationships between documents, identifying connections and inconsistencies across entire document repositories.
